WebSep 16, 2024 · The principle of this assay is that living cells have intact cell membranes that exclude the trypan blue stain, whereas dead cells do not. Cell suspension is mixed with the trypan blue stain and examined visually under light microscopy to determine whether cells include or exclude the stain. WebViable cells maintain a reducing environment within their cytoplasm. The alamarBlue Reagent is an oxidized form of redox indicator that is blue in color and non-fluorescent. … Web1) AlamarBlue® is an indicator dye, that incorporates an oxidation-reduction (REDOX) indicator that both fluoresces and changes colour in response to the chemical reduction of growth medium,...
